Hungarian to decide where his future lies

West Brom expect to find out in the next few days whether Zoltan Gera will be rejoining the club. Midfielder Gera, 32, was signed by Roy Hodgson for Fulham back in 2008, after four years with the Baggies where he became a fans' favourite. Hodgson is now keen to take him back to The Hawthorns although an unnamed Serie A side are also interested in the Hungarian's signature. Gera's agent, Vladan Filipovic, said: "The negotiations are in a period where we can agree anytime (with a club). "It can happen that Gera's future will be decided next day - or we could close the negotiations next week. "But it's not a secret that we are at the finish." Gera spent four years with Ferencvaros before moving to West Brom in 2004, and he could now be part of their plans for next season.
